Linux Steam Client On Rampage

By
News
– March 8, 2013Posted in: News, Opinion, Submitted

Just a few weeks after the official release of the Linux client for Valve’s Steam gaming platform, Linux gamers are on rampage, making up more than two percent of all Steam users.

Valve has recently released its Steam Hardware and Software Survey for February 2013, and the results are remarkable for the Linux community. We observe a very impressive adoption rate, thus more and more Linux users make use of Steam for their gaming experience. Notably, Valve ran an amazing discount for Linux games, let’s say about 70% discount in every Linux game.
